Being a Newbie has it’s Advantages

If you are anything like I was when I first entered the Internet Marketing arena,
you probably go through occasional bouts of  “the poor me’s.”  Poor me, I don’t know
where to start.  Poor me, I don’t have a web site. I don’t have a product to sell.
I don’t know how to blog.   OK, that is where we all start.  Ground zero -  Day one.

Now, here is the good news.  All of those things you don’t have
can actually work for you.  Think about it this way.

You are starting with a clean slate.  You have no bad habits to unlearn.
Marketers who have been doing this for a while and are already generating
an online income are usually hesitant to change things.

The old adage, “If it works, don’t fix it” applies here too and is often just an
excuse to keep from fixing things that are barely working.

Right now, you have low start-up and overhead costs.
I know some marketers who have as many as eighty people on their payroll,
with offices in two, or three places around the country.
Does that sound like time freedom to you?
Well, I personally would rather not run my business that way!

Once you get a web site, you will only have one to manage.  Some marketers have
literally hundreds of web sites. Can you imagine how difficult it would be
to go back and, for example, add audio/video to all those sites?

You don’t have to rework your entire business model to incorporate new technology.
You can build your business around it. Yes, there is a lot to learn, but that is
part of the fun. You can design your business to be exactly what
you want it to be and run exactly the way you want it to run.

How you decide to do it is your choice. Learn everything you can about the marketer
who is doing what you want to do and do exactly the same things.
Of course you can leave out all the mistakes he made on the way to success!
